Transaction 3f6b71176a4a849db7fc021833009d81542dbb31d989c78c8655255c7638a0e8

2 Input
2 Outputs
  • 3f6b71176a4a849db7fc021833009d81542dbb31d989c78c8655255c7638a0e8:0
  • value  47240000
    address  1Gf2h2DC5Q78eSuA8AfNUGpFendghpz5ax
  • 3f6b71176a4a849db7fc021833009d81542dbb31d989c78c8655255c7638a0e8:1
  • value  44176812
    address  159723xUXc3TuF92kGS56RBZwnk7Hp9Fez